BONUS REVIEW by KIRK JACKSON

The time for talk at the house called Lovecraft is over, and the time for big bad action is here! Therefore, this issue gets right down to business. No word balloons even appear until 10 pages into the book, so there is nothing to slow the action down! What you’re left with is a truly epic battle with all of the characters’ attention focused on the violence, and once it is over, any words that are uttered mean that much more. The later scenes make great use of those “silent but pregnant” moments showing us what quiet scenes can do without dialogue. That doesn’t mean there are no words however, as our heroes make some headway in figuring out their roles in all of the craziness. The remains one of the most unique books on the stands today!
I give it 10 out of 10 Grahams
